The Technology and Information Management in Facilities It is a rapidly expanding field, driven by the growing demand for professionals capable of integrating innovative solutions into building and space management. This course, Technology and Information Management in Facilities, will allow you to acquire essential skills in the implementation of management software, 3D modeling and the use of emerging technologies such as IoT and Big Data. The importance of this field lies in optimizing resources and improving sustainability in facilities management. Objectives

– Understand how to use management software to optimize maintenance and incident management in facilities.

– Apply 3D modeling techniques to improve life cycle management in BIM.

– Identify IoT applications that promote efficiency in building management.

– Analyze the impact of Big Data on decision-making in facility management.

– Evaluate the use of LIDAR technologies for data collection at facilities.

– Integrate video surveillance systems to improve space management and security.

– Develop skills in the use of UAS and photogrammetry for inspections of large areas.
